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an for extraction and drying. Our team will identify the source of the water and the best course of action. This step typically takes 30 minutes to 1 hour, depending on the complexity of the job.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ians will use specialized equ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ps, to remove the water from under your carpet.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. This step typically takes 2-4 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. Our team will ensure that your home is safe and dry within 3-5 days. This step is critical to preventing mold growth and further damage.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ning

Finally, our technicians will sanitize and clean the affected area to prevent any remaining bacteria or contaminants. Our team will leave your home feeling fresh and clean. This step typically takes 1-2 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Under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No DIY cleanup is usually enough for small spills.
Large water spill (over 1 gallon) or water damage under carpet No Yes Professional extraction and drying are necessary to prevent further damage and health risks.
Visible water stains or discoloration on walls or ceiling No Yes Professional assessment and repair are necessary to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Professional sanitizing and cleaning are necessary to remove mold and mildew.
Water damage in high-traffic areas or near electrical outlets No Yes Professional assessment and repair are necessary to prevent further damage and safety risks.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Alexandria, VA

The cost of Under Carpet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Alexandria, VA. Our team will provide a detailed, itemized estimate and work closely with you to ensure your satisfaction.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ment used
Sanitizing and c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of contaminants, and equipment used
Repair or replacement of flooring or walls $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of material, and labor costs
Equipment rental and usage fees $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and rental duration
Travel fees (for locations outside of Alexandria, VA) $100 – $500 Distance from our location, traffic conditions, and time of day
